How to Sell Your Inherited Home Fast in Harrisburg, PA

Inheriting a property can be both a gift and a challenge, especially if you’re looking to sell it quickly. Whether you’re managing an estate or need to handle expenses tied to the home, selling an inherited property in Harrisburg, PA, can be a streamlined process if you follow the right steps. Here’s how to get started and maximize your chances for a fast sale.

1. Assess the Property’s Condition

Before listing your inherited home, take time to assess its condition. Many inherited homes may need updates, repairs, or even a thorough cleaning to attract potential buyers. However, if you’re looking to sell quickly, you can choose to sell the property as-is or make only minor updates.

Quick Tips:

  • Clean and Declutter: Remove personal items and unnecessary clutter to help buyers envision themselves in the space.
  • Minor Repairs: Small updates like painting or fixing leaky faucets can improve appeal.
  • Decide on ‘As-Is’ Sales: If the home needs significant repairs, consider selling it as-is to speed up the sale process.

2. Understand Any Legal and Tax Obligations

Inherited properties often come with specific legal and tax responsibilities. Depending on the estate’s size and Pennsylvania’s regulations, you might have inheritance taxes or capital gains tax considerations. Consulting with a probate or tax attorney can clarify these obligations.

Key Points:

  • Inheritance Tax: Pennsylvania has an inheritance tax that could apply to your property.
  • Title Transfer: Make sure the title is transferred to your name before the sale.

3. Price the Property Competitively for a Quick Sale

A well-priced property can attract buyers and lead to a faster sale. Research the current Harrisburg market, or work with a real estate agent to determine a competitive price for the inherited home. Overpricing can slow down the process, while a fair, competitive price can draw interest from serious buyers.

Pro Tip: Look at recent sales of similar homes in the area to get a sense of pricing and adjust accordingly for a fast sale.

4. Consider Selling to a Cash Buyer

If speed is your primary goal, selling to a cash buyer might be the best route. Cash buyers, including real estate investors, often buy properties as-is and close quickly, sometimes within a week or two. This option can save you time and money on repairs, showings, and lengthy closing processes.

Benefits of Cash Buyers:

  • Quick Close: Cash buyers can close fast, sometimes in just days.
  • No Repairs Needed: Sell the property as-is, without repair costs.
  • Fewer Fees: Avoid many traditional closing and commission fees.
